Background
Siegel, Sarah Ellin was born on July 13, 1965 in Stamford, Connecticut, United States. Daughter of Herman Max and Edythe Rose (Prens) Siegel.

Student, Hebrew University, Jerusalem, 1986. Bachelor with high honors, University Michigan, 1987.
Technical writer Sears Technology Services, Shaumburg, Illinois, 1990-1993. Technical editor Advantis Electronic Newsletter, 1993-1994. Editor-in-chief Advantis web site, 1994-1995, International Business Machines Corporation Global Network web site, Shaumburg, 1995-1996.
Web producer International Business Machines Corporation Software Group, Somers, New York, 1996-1998, manager electronic marketing, since 1998. Co-anchor and producer The 10% Show, Gay Cable Network, Chicago, 1988-1991. Web consultant Hetrick-Martin Institute, New York City, since 1997.
Member International Business Machines Corporation Corporation Gay and Lesbian Task Force, Somers, since 1998. Speaker in field.
Member National Organization Gay and Lesbian Scientists and Technology Professionals.
Life partner Patricia Hewitt.
